If Unity Connection is integrated with an LDAP directory, the web application password and password settings (for example, password-complexity settings and whether the password expires) are controlled by the LDAP server. Note Users can also use the Messaging Assistant to change the passwords and PINs. Securing and Changing the Web Application (Cisco PCA) Password You can change the and specify the web application password and voicemail PIN settings for users from Cisco Unity Connection Administration. The Cisco PCA password is referred to as the Web Application password in Cisco Unity Connection Administration. Note Each user must be assigned a unique password with the following properties: • The password must contain at least three of the following four characters: an uppercase character, a lowercase character, a number, or a symbol. • The password cannot contain the user alias or its reverse. • The password cannot contain the primary extension or any alternate extensions. • A character cannot be used more than three times consecutively (for example, !Cooool). The characters cannot all be consecutive, in ascending or descending order (for example, abcdef or fedcba). Following are the considerations when securing Cisco PCA passwords for users: • Users can change the Cisco PCA password only using the Messaging Assistant. • The Cisco PCA password is not related to the Unity Connection phone PIN and the two are not synchronized. The users do not change the Cisco PCA passwords when prompted to change the phone PIN during first time enrollment. Users that can access voice messages using an IMAP client must change the Cisco PCA password when updating the password in IMAP client. Passwords are not synchronized between IMAP clients and Cisco PCA. If users have trouble receiving voice messages in an IMAP client after updating Cisco PCA password, see the "Troubleshooting IMAP Client Sign-In Problems in Cisco Unity Connection" section in the "Configuring an Email Account to Access Cisco Unity Connection Voice Messages" chapter of the User Workstation Setup Guide for Cisco Unity Connection Release 15, available at https://www.cisco.com/c/en/us/td/docs/voice_ip_ comm/connection/15/user_setup/guide/b_15cucuwsx.html. Roles You can assign different roles (System Roles and Custom Roles) to a user from the Edit Roles page of a user or the associated user template. System Roles are the predefined roles provided by Unity Connection whereas Custom Roles are the roles that the administrator creates based on the requirements.
